The Academic session starts in June and ends
in May (As per the Gauhati University Academic
calendar).
v
Application for admission into the
college should be made in the prescribed form attached
with Prospectus which can be obtained from the college
office on payment of Rs. 50/- only.
v
Admission to H.S. 1st year
course is held after the announcement of the H.S.L.C.
Examination result and to the B.A./ B.Sc. course after
the H.S Final Examination result.
v
The dates of admission into various
classes are notified in the local News Papers and the
College Notice Board.
v
Admission will be strictly on the basis
of merit and is governed by the college admission
rules. The decision of the Admission Committee
regarding admission is final.
v
Any pressure or interference from any
quarter for admission of a particular student will
result in forfeiture of the claim.
v
All admission will made to the college
are provisional and subject to the approval of the
AHSEC / G.U. The College will not responsible if the
AHSEC/ G.U. does not approve the admission of any
student on ground of lack of Migration Certificate /
Eligibility certificate or for furnishing wrong or
false documents and statement.
v
Candidates are required to produce the
original copies of the following documents at the time
of interview.

Reservation:
·
There is provision for reservation of
seats for students belonging to SC, ST(P), ST(H), OBC,
MOBC and Physically handicap categories as per State
Govt. rules. Such categories of students shall have to
produce certificate form the competent authority.
·
10 seats are reserved for students
having records of outstanding performances in the
extra curricular activities like sports, culture N.C.C.
and others for H.S. and T.D.C 1st year
classes each.
